The TN100 transceiver is a highly integrated mixed signal chip that uses CSS (chirp spread
spectrum) wireless communication technology. With its unique ranging capability, the TN100
can measure the link distance between two nodes. Thus, the TN100 supports location
awareness applications including location-based services (LBS) and asset tracking (2D/3D
RTLS). Ranging is performed during regular data communication and does not require
additional infrastructure, power, and/or bandwidth. The TN100 transceiver IC is designed to
build up robust, short distance wireless networks operating in the 2.45 GHz ISM band with
extremely low power consumption over a wide range of operating temperatures.
The TN100 supports 7-frequency channels with 3 non-overlapping channels. This provides
support for multiple physically independent networks and improved coexistence
performance with existing 2.4 GHz wireless technologies. Data rates are selectable between
2 Mbps and 125 kbps. The TN100 transceiver includes a sophisticated Medium Access
Controller (MAC) with CSMA/CA and TDMA support as well as forward error correction
(FEC) and 128-bit hardware encryption. Through its high-speed standard SPI interface, the
TN100 can be interfaced with an external microcontroller. It includes a 4-kbit frame buffer so
that several receive and transmit frames can be stored simultaneously in the buffers. This
solution eliminates the problems of different peak data rates between air and microcontroller
interfaces.
ST's STM32 family of 32-bit Flash microcontrollers is based on the breakthrough ARM
Cortex™-M3 core - a core specifically developed for embedded applications. The STM32
family benefits from the Cortex-M3 architectural enhancements including the Thumb®-2
instruction set to deliver improved performance with better code density, significantly faster
response to interrupts, all combined with industry leading power consumption.
